软件开发中的质量控制和项目交付管理

在软件开发过程中,质量控制和项目交付管理是至关重要的环节。质量控制可以帮助团队确保最终交付的软件具有良好的质量和性能,而项目交付管理可以帮助团队按时按质地完成项目交付。下面将介绍软件开发中如何进行质量控制和项目交付管理的策略。

质量控制策略

在软件开发过程中,质量控制策略包括以下几个方面:

  • 需求分析:在项目启动阶段,团队需要与业务人员充分沟通,确保对需求有充分理解,并将需求明确地记录下来。
  • 设计评审:在设计阶段,团队需要进行设计评审,确保软件的设计符合需求,并且具有良好的可扩展性和可维护性。
  • 编码规范:团队需要遵守统一的编码规范,编写出易读易维护的代码。
  • 单元测试:开发人员需要进行单元测试,确保代码的质量和功能的正确实现。
  • 集成测试:在集成阶段,团队需要进行集成测试,确保不同模块之间的协作和整体系统的功能正常。
  • 性能测试:团队需要进行性能测试,确保系统在高负载情况下依然具有良好的性能。
  • 用户验收测试:在交付阶段,团队需要与用户进行验收测试,确保软件符合用户的需求。

项目交付管理策略

在软件项目交付管理中,有几个关键的策略需要团队重点关注:

  • 里程碑规划:项目经理需要为项目设定清晰的里程碑,确保项目按时按质地完成。
  • 风险管理:团队需要对项目中的风险进行及时的识别和管理,以避免项目因风险而延期或失败。
  • 资源分配:项目经理需要合理地分配团队资源,确保项目开发过程中没有资源瓶颈。
  • 沟通协调:团队需要保持良好的内部沟通和协调,确保项目各项工作顺利进行。
  • 变更管理:团队需要建立有效的变更管理机制,确保项目变更对项目进度和质量的影响最小化。
  • 客户关系管理:项目经理需要与客户保持良好的关系,确保项目交付符合客户期望。

结语

在软件开发过程中,质量控制和项目交付管理是项目成功的关键。团队需要根据项目的特点和需求,制定适合的质量控制和项目交付管理策略,以确保项目顺利完成并得到客户的认可。

希望以上内容对您有所帮助,谢谢阅读!

转载请注明出处:http://www.zxzgglz.com/article/20240614/34485.html

随机推荐